Dairy products Products



Ensure to appreciate milk items as they're superb for advertising healthy and balanced teeth and periodontals. Right here are three reasons why:

1. Calcium-rich: Dairy items such as milk, cheese, and yogurt are loaded with calcium, a mineral crucial for maintaining strong teeth and bones. Calcium aids to remineralize tooth enamel and protect against dental cavity.



2. Vitamin D resource: Lots of milk items are strengthened with vitamin D, which plays an important role in calcium absorption. Vitamin D assists the body make use of calcium effectively, making sure that your teeth and gums obtain the maximum benefits.

3. Healthy protein power: Milk items are additionally a fantastic source of healthy protein, which is necessary for fixing and developing tissues in the mouth. Healthy protein aids to strengthen the periodontals and sustains total oral health and wellness.

Crunchy Fruits and Vegetables



When snacking on crispy vegetables and fruits, you can successfully improve the health and wellness of your teeth and gums. These healthy treats work as all-natural tooth brushes, aiding to get rid of plaque and food particles from your teeth.

The act of chewing on crunchy fruits and vegetables also boosts saliva manufacturing, which aids to reduce the effects of acid and stop tooth decay. In addition, the coarse texture of these foods can help to strengthen your gum tissues and advertise better overall dental health.

Some instances of crunchy vegetables and fruits that benefit your teeth consist of apples, carrots, celery, and cucumbers.

Nuts and Seeds



Are you familiar with the benefits of incorporating nuts and seeds right into your diet plan for keeping healthy and balanced teeth and periodontals? These tiny however magnificent treats can really do marvels for your dental wellness.

Here are three reasons why you should take into consideration adding nuts and seeds to your day-to-day routine:

1. Rich in crucial nutrients: Nuts and seeds are packed with minerals and vitamins that are important for maintaining strong teeth and periodontals. They have calcium, phosphorus, and magnesium, which help to reinforce tooth enamel and prevent dental cavity.

2. Promote saliva manufacturing: Eating on nuts and seeds stimulates saliva manufacturing, which is essential for maintaining your mouth moist and washing away harmful bacteria. Saliva also includes enzymes that aid in digestion and neutralize acid in the mouth.

3. Natural abrasiveness: Nuts and seeds have an all-natural abrasiveness that can assist get rid of plaque and food bits from the surface area of your teeth. This can add to a cleaner and much healthier mouth overall.

Green Tea



Boost your oral wellness by including environment-friendly tea into your day-to-day routine, as it's loaded with anti-oxidants and can help enhance and shield your teeth and periodontals.

Below are 3 reasons eco-friendly tea is helpful for your oral health and wellness:

1. Minimizes the threat of gum condition: Green tea includes catechins, which have antibacterial properties that help deal with versus the germs in charge of periodontal condition. Routine consumption of green tea can aid lower swelling and protect against gum illness.

2. Avoids tooth decay: The natural fluoride content in eco-friendly tea helps enhance tooth enamel, making it extra resistant to acid strikes and degeneration. It additionally hinders the growth of bacteria that cause cavities, keeping your teeth healthy and solid.

3. Refreshes breath: Eco-friendly tea has polyphenols that aid get rid of bad breath by lowering the microorganisms in charge of causing it. By integrating green tea into your everyday routine, you can take pleasure in fresher breath and improved dental health.

Water



Consuming water is a vital part of maintaining healthy and balanced teeth and gums. Water aids to remove food fragments and bacteria that can result in dental cavity and gum tissue condition. It's advised to consume water after dishes and treats to aid rinse your mouth and minimize the threat of tooth cavities.

Water also assists in the manufacturing of saliva, which is very important for maintaining your mouth wet and reducing the effects of acids that can deteriorate tooth enamel.

In addition, remaining moisturized with water can help prevent completely dry mouth, a condition that can contribute to halitosis and dental caries.
